Airhogs Fall In Series Finale 3-0

August 18, 2016 - American Association (AA)
Texas AirHogs News Release


LAREDO, Texas - The AirHogs fell to the Laredo Lemurs 3-0 Wednesday at Uni-Trade Stadium. Starter David Wayne Russo fired 6 innings of 1-run, 5-hit ball but suffered the loss.

The AirHogs were held to just 4 hits over 8 frames by Laredo starter Ryan Beckman, who picked up his 7th win with the scoreless start.

Lemurs 1st baseman Abel Nieves went deep off Russo in the bottom of the 1st, putting the home team up 1-0 early. Russo bore down after though, at one point retiring 9 straight to keep it 1-0 before turning the ball over to Cody Culp in the 7th.

Laredo tagged the 2nd AirHogs relief man Jack Karraker for 2 runs on a double, a triple, and an error in the bottom half of the 8th. Jeff Inman earned his 12th save of the year with a scoreless 9th.

The AirHogs (28-55) enjoy an off day tomorrow before opening a 3-game series vs. the Kansas City T-Bones at CommunityAmerica Ballpark Friday at 7:05.
